Vision-based autonomous tracking

Track targets (people, specific moving objects) within the visual range in real time. High real-time tracking, video traffic refresh rates up to 25-30 fps. Supports online learning of the following target characteristics with good robustness performance. The real-time confidence level of the tracked target is displayed by adjusting the color of the tracking box (green → red, 100% → 0%).

 

Vision-based autonomous obstacle avoidance

Avoid obstacles within 0,8 m of the robot's field of view. The distribution of obstacles within the robot's field of view can be monitored in real time, and the position of the robot's body can be adjusted. Real-time display of the robot's body angle, maximum distance and area within the field of view, and the range of the upcoming walking path.

 

Ultimate hardware and software reliability

Deeply involved in the field of four-legged robots for over 6 years. At CES 2020, a single A1 set successfully demonstrated over 80 consecutive backflips. The closed-loop flipping algorithm is used to ensure movement stability.
